Study Details

50 Patients with recalcitrant exudative age-related macular degeneration with a history of retinal or subretinal fluid after multiple intravitreal injections with ranibizumab 0.5mg and subsequently treated with ranibizumab 2.0mg, who are incomplete responders to 2.0mg of ranibizumab.

Arms

  • Other: 2.0 mg intravitreal Aflibercept
    open label, Subjects seen monthly \& given mandatory 2.0 mg aflibercept at baseline, months 1, 2 and 4. Pro re nata (PRN) retreatment at months 3 and 5 was performed upon evidence of disease on spectral domain-optical coherence tomography (SD-OCT)

Primary Outcome Measure

The Number of Patients With no Fluid on OCT [ Time Frame: 6 months ]
